🍼 What is a Peristaltic Silicone Nipple?
A peristaltic nipple is designed to mimic the way a baby suckles at the breast — using a wave-like tongue movement (aka peristalsis). These nipples encourage natural sucking, which can help prevent nipple confusion and promote healthy oral development.

🍼 How to Use a Peristaltic Silicone Nipple
1. Choose the Right Flow Rate
-
SS or Slow flow (0–3 months): Ideal for newborns, prevents choking.
-
M or Medium flow (3–6 months): Good as baby starts to feed faster.
-
L or Fast flow (6+ months): For babies who can handle more milk per suck.
-
Some brands use letters or numbers (check the packaging!).
2. Attach It to the Bottle Properly
-
Insert the nipple into the bottle ring.
-
Make sure it’s fully seated — the nipple should “click” or stretch snugly into place with no gaps.
-
Screw it onto the bottle — but not too tight (especially for anti-colic systems that need airflow).
3. Hold the Bottle Correctly
-
Tilt the bottle so the nipple is always full of milk to avoid air bubbles.
-
Support your baby’s head and neck — a semi-upright position is best to reduce reflux.
4. Watch Baby’s Feeding Cues
-
With peristaltic nipples, babies can control the pace better.
-
Let them pause when they need to — don’t force the flow.
-
If milk drips out too fast, try a slower-flow nipple.
5. After Feeding
-
Disassemble the bottle and rinse everything in warm, soapy water.
-
Use a nipple brush to gently clean inside if needed.
-
Sterilize regularly (especially for babies under 6 months).
💡 Tips for Success
-
Warm the nipple slightly before feeding to make it feel more breast-like.
-
Switch to larger sizes as baby grows, but follow their lead — some babies prefer slower flow longer.
-
If baby seems fussy, gassy, or overwhelmed by milk flow, try a slower nipple or check for a clog in the vent.
